Players are heading a bicycle racing team. Each team has three cyclists and managing the team depending on the racetrack is the object of the game. Using the strengths of each team member at the right moment in time is decisive for winning the race.
Nearest places to play
Play Online
Sorry, we can’t still find where to play this game online.
If you know, please email us via [email protected]